June 16th: George Stinney Executed (Mary Thames and Betty Binnicker)(1944)

Racism has been playing a role in crime for longer than we would care to admit. On June 16th 1944 a young boy was put to death for a crime that, depending on what side you land on, was either a gross miscarriage of justice or a biased trial of a guilty individual.
